Establishing FPSO integrity through structural digital twin technology
- Akselos empowered Shell’s engineers, from unlocking 20 years of asset life expectancy for their North Sea Platform to an industry validation of Akselos’ 48-hour digital thread workflow.
- Akselos digital twin provides 100x more detail than the Shell Bonga FPSO digital twin.
- Reduced basis finite element analysis (RB-FEA), Akselos proprietary algorithm, provides 1000x speedup compared to traditional Finite Element Analysis.
- Akselos implemented a digital thread workflow for the Shell Bonga FPSO that incorporated sensor and inspection data into the Digital Twin model.
- Akselos Digital Twin minimises inspection cost, identify critical integrity hotspots, reduce maintenance cost and extend the life of the Shell Bonga FPSO.
